Transaction 58edba2bdb88590296801bccf9cb11eba1e5b47c9ad39f714827c260c70bf3ad
1 Input
2 Outputs
- 58edba2bdb88590296801bccf9cb11eba1e5b47c9ad39f714827c260c70bf3ad:0
- 58edba2bdb88590296801bccf9cb11eba1e5b47c9ad39f714827c260c70bf3ad:1
value 1082508
address 35dvqCD3Y4zixdN4kr49cp87ND8oRopHku
value 1444682
address 1CF7en4PRRSdf13fbVaKaUyWCMmCAt6vNB